From 21b3a0772b97b1af05de76c5889b0e7b8d6c3bda Mon Sep 17 00:00:00 2001 From: ed Date: Wed, 18 Dec 2019 10:29:55 +0100 Subject: [PATCH] read and write file func added --- main.go | 13 +++++++++++++ 1 file changed, 13 insertions(+) diff --git a/main.go b/main.go index 8c14f75..6113906 100644 --- a/main.go +++ b/main.go @@ -46,6 +46,19 @@ func decrypt(sealed []byte, key []byte) []byte { return data } +func file2data(filename string) []byte { + data, err := ioutil.ReadFile(filename) + checkErr(err) + return data +} + +func data2file(filename string, data []byte) { + f, err := os.Create(filename) + checkErr(err) + defer f.Close() + f.Write(data) +} + func main() { var passwd string = "ThisAnnPassphrase" fmt.Println(passwd)